Transaction 3e21faca4c7abe02d479500e7e9fe811c02e87ad7d7c0a5d7ce47786245a6736

1 Input
2 Outputs
  • 3e21faca4c7abe02d479500e7e9fe811c02e87ad7d7c0a5d7ce47786245a6736:0
  • value  7993952
    address  14TM6XLM9TT9vTd7KWqPM3vB9Zr9RCLBVA
  • 3e21faca4c7abe02d479500e7e9fe811c02e87ad7d7c0a5d7ce47786245a6736:1
  • value  12000000
    address  3CTX9MyuvxQwB35c3rjQ6VCQa9ia8sEPjd